ESP32传感器选型指南:红外PIR vs 毫米波雷达,哪种人体检测方案更适合你的项目?
在智能家居和物联网项目中,人体检测传感器的选择往往决定了整个系统的响应精度和用户体验。当开发者面对琳琅满目的传感器选项时,如何根据实际场景在红外PIR(热释电传感器)和毫米波雷达之间做出明智选择?本文将深入剖析两种技术的核心差异,结合家庭安防、智慧办公等典型场景,提供可落地的选型策略。
1. 技术原理与核心差异
1.1 红外PIR传感器工作原理
红外热释电传感器通过检测人体发出的8-14μm红外辐射工作。当人体进入探测区域时,传感器内部的双元热电元件会因温度变化产生电荷信号。典型特性包括:
- 运动依赖型检测:仅对移动热源敏感
- 菲涅尔透镜决定探测范围(常见60°-110°)
- 易受环境温度干扰(最佳工作环境温差>2℃)
// PIR基础检测代码示例
const int pirPin = 13; // GPIO13连接PIR输出
void setup() {
Serial.begin(115200);
pinMode(pirPin, INPUT);
}
void loop() {
int state = digitalRead(pirPin);
Serial.println(state ? "Movement detected" : "No movement");
delay(200);
}
1.2 毫米波雷达技术解析
以LD2410为代表的24GHz雷达模块采用多普勒效应原理,通过分析反射波频率变化检测微动。关键优势:
- 静态存在检测:可感知呼吸等微动作
- 距离分

373

被折叠的 条评论
为什么被折叠?



